Solice Kirsk posted:

As for an unpopular opinion:

I think burgers are better well done. It's not a steak or a roast, cook your drat burger.

It's just safer too.
Bacteria grows on the outside of beef, hence why it's okay to cook a steak blue, you just heat it enough on each side to kill off the bacteria.
With ground beef, all that surface area has been ground up and mixed throughout.
